Jamdani: The Weaving cloth Tradition


Jamdani is an excellent muslin textile together with intricate patterns unique into the fabric. Beginning from the Bengal region (present-day Bangladesh and India), Jamdani is known for the unique craftsmanship and refined weaving techniques.

Characteristics of Jamdani:


Intricate Patterns: Jamdani sarees are handwoven with patterns that will appear to drift on the surface of the particular fabric. These habits are usually floral or geometric in nature.
Labor-Intensive Process: The particular weaving of Jamdani is a labor intensive process, requiring immense skill. Each saree will take weeks or even even months to be able to complete.

Saree: The Timeless Hang


The Saree is undoubtedly the most iconic garments inside women's fashion, specially in South Asia. This consists of a long piece of cloth, usually around 6 to nine back yards, draped round the body in various variations.

Key Popular features of the Saree:


Flexibility: The saree could be styled in several ways, from the traditional drape to be able to more modern types where it will be paired with a seatbelt or worn using a crop top-style blouse.
Rich History: The particular saree includes a historical past dating back thousands of years. It has advanced over time, with different regions of India having their distinctive draping styles plus fabric choices.
Fabric Variety: Sarees come throughout an array involving fabrics like man made fibre, cotton, chiffon, georgette, and organza. Each and every fabric lends alone to a diverse look, whether it's for daily wear or special events.
